Dometic Refrigerators

Has anyone had problems with their Dometic refrigerators losing the amonia coolant. We have a unit that is 2.5 years old. There have a number of failures here in our area. Any input would be appreciated.

Ours went belly up in 2004 after 4+ years of full timing. It lost its ammonia (or whatever it is called). Somehow it leaked out. My smeller is bad so I couldn't smell it. But when it doesn't cool, that's a good sign the ammonia is gone. Had it replaced under extended warranty (sure glad I had it because these buggers are not cheap).

There was also a recent recall on the Dometic units concerning a problem with rust through and loss of coolant, some resulting in fires.

Dometic should be able to compare your serial number to verify.

We had one of the units that was under the recall. It was about 5 years old. We had the recall "fix". That consisted of a heat shield. Then about a month after they had "fixed" the unit it quit cooling. Called the Dometic folks and they said they would fix the cooling unit that failed at their cost. Local dealer did not believe they would and was somewhat surprised that they did in fact cover the complete cost.

As Hazmic indicate since it is still under warranty get it into a dealer and get it checked out. Also go to the Dometic web site and see it your unit is covered under the recall.

Yes, my used 05 Dometic 2862 just lost Ammonia in less than 3 years.
As second owner, Dometic won't aid.
Given that their Fridge is so unreliable, I just replaced with a Whirlpool Apt Size Fridge for much less than $400. Did have to shave and sand down the woodwork a little to squeeze it in - somehow 24" wide was not the same for both brands!
The new Residential Fridge is of course larger inside and self-defrosting. Works great. Plug it in while loading - is cold in 30 minutes. All is still cold by time we reach campground. May get Generator or batteries and inverter someday...safer than propane.

my problem with the dometic refridgerator is that it does not convert to gas when power is off...checked gas intake and it is fine
what could be the cause of it not working on gas all of a sudden

Doesn't switch to gas? So...can you hear the auto ignitor sparking? This should trigger when it looses shore power or if you select the Gas mode. After a time out period it should turn on the Check light if it has not ignited the burner. This the case your having? Make sure there are not spider webs or such in the burner tube...keep us posted on any other clues.

Make sure there is not a recall on it. Our '02 had a recall that we did not know about. The coolant leaked while the fridge was on propane power...caused a fire...totaled the rig. If you have a problem with leaking coolant, strongly suggest leaving it off until repaired.
